Lebanese Cabinet Approves Seeking Foreign Help to Train Security Services

Posted on: Friday, 30 September 2005, 09:00 CDT

Text of report by Lebanese Hezbollah TV Al-Manar on 30 September

[Presenter] The Lebanese cabinet has approved Prime Minister Fu'ad al-Sanyurah's request to seek the assistance of foreign expertise, especially US expertise, in training Lebanese security forces despite Hezbollah's objection to the request. During the session, which lasted over five hours, Water and Energy Minister Muhammad Funaysh said that Hezbollah maintains its objection to this request because it is suspicious of the integrity and true goals of the Americans.

For his part, Prime Minister Fu'ad al-Sanyurah said that the request will be pursued despite this objection. Answering a question, he said that this matter will not affect ministerial solidarity. He added that this request for expert assistance is not the first of its kind in Lebanon and will be limited to technical issues with no effect on Lebanese sovereignty. He noted that a number of countries, such as Russia, have expressed their willingness to assist Lebanon in this area.

[Al-Sanyurah] The issue of seeking expert assistance in training and obtaining some in-kind grants is not unprecedented in Lebanon, which has for long resorted to this policy with regard to its security and military services. This matter was deliberated on, and the decision was made to maintain this policy. We reject subordination to anyone; we will not exchange the custodianship of one country for another, not at all. Lebanon is its own custodian; there will be no custodianship. We welcome anyone wishing to extend unconditional assistance. As for demands, no one has presented us with any demands whatsoever.

Let us get over this issue and end self-flagellation. Let us think how we can help one another and receive foreign assistance while preserving our dignity and stressing our rejection of subordination to others. [Video shows Cabinet in session, al- Sanyurah addressing news conference]
